Namaste everyone on the forum.
I live in Europe. I have been trying to get in touch with a Shakta guru for 3 years. The reason is that I have a very strong desire to learn the sadhana of Kalika (and later perhaps some other Mahavidyas). I read everything I could find in English. I emailed dozens of temples, ashrams all over India. I spoke with several Indians on FB. I even visited a center of the Ramakrishna Mission in Europe, but I had to realize that they are more into Vedanta than Shakta path. Many Indians told me that even if I traveled to India (a huge expense), I would most likely not be able to find other than fake Tantrics who make a living of religion. During those 3 years there was a time when I chanted mantras I found on the internet, but I heard from several sources that it is either useless, or even harmful to start reciting beej mantras without proper diksha, so I became hesitant and stopped. Why is it so difficult to find a Shakta parampara? For instance, if I wanted to find a Vaishnav guru, there would be a huge variety of different lineages to choose from: Sri Vaisnavas, Gaudiyas, Nimbarkis, Gaura-Nagaris, etc. Is Shaktism disappearing in India? Or what is the reason it is so extremely difficult to find honest and realized sadhus who transmit mantra diksha?
Please share your thoughts. Thanks.
